Accessible Social Media Practices: Thoughtful Inclusion of People with Disabilities in Dissemination Practices

Wed, 9/13/2023 at 1:00 pm - Wed, 9/13/2023 at 2:30 pm (PDT)

Learn why and how to make social media content accessible for people with disabilities. We encourage health education program coordinators, facilitators and peer leaders to take part.

After completing training, you will be able to:

  • Explain the importance of accessibility and inclusiveness
  • Recognize the need for inclusive practices in social media posting
  • Identify access barriers faced by social media users with disabilities
  • Implement methods to address access barriers
  • Apply recommendations from the best practice guide
  • Demonstrate accessible social media techniques
